Hi,

Oracle8i not started automatically on win2k machine. The service oracleserviceorcl(startuptype=automatic) not started automatically. the status was starting.
But i able to start the database using svrmgrl application. Why win2k not start the service oracleserviceorcl automatic.

oracle service is not doin its job.
you can create a new service and make it autostart using ORADIM

----------------------------------------------------------------------

rem Delete the old service
ORADIM -DELETE -SID test -SRVC servicename

rem Create a new services with the STARTMODE AUTO property
oradim -new -sid TEST -intpwd ORACLE -startmode AUTO -pfile C:orantadminTESTpfileinitTEST.ora
